is a small rural village, located sixteen kilometres from town on the R736 regional road. It is close to and six kilometres from the fishing village of . As of the 2022 census, the population of the village was 544. is situated 3 km north of Kilmore Post Office.

is a fishing village on the south coast of , with a population of about 400. It's a centre for yachting and sea-angling, and boat trips sail to the nature reserve of Great Saltee Island.
